Add 45/42 and 63/9
1st number: 1 3/42, 2nd number: 7 0/9
45/42 + 63/9 is 113/14.
Steps for adding fractions
-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
LCM of 42 and 9 is 126
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 126 - For the 1st fraction, since 42 × 3 = 126,
45/42 = 45 × 3/42 × 3 = 135/126 -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 9 × 14 = 126,
63/9 = 63 × 14/9 × 14 = 882/126 - Add the two like fractions:
135/126 + 882/126 = 135 + 882/126 = 1017/126 - 1017/126 simplified gives 113/14
- So, 45/42 + 63/9 = 113/14
